CYCLIZATION OF PHENYLPROPIOLIC ACID ON TITANOCENE. SYNTHESIS AND MOLECULAR STRUCTURE OF DI-η5-CYCLOPENTADIENYL(CINNAMYLATO-C3,O)TITANIUM/PHENYLPROPIOLIC ACID (1/1), A NOVEL TITANACYCLE, SYNTHESIS OF DICYCLOPENTADIENYLBIS(PHENYLPROPIOLATO)TITANIUM
Samuel, E.,Atwood, Jerry L.,Hunter, William E.
, p. 325 - 332 (1986)
Dimethyltitanocene reacts with phenylpropiolic acid under hydrogen and with the assistance of light to yield the dark red titanium(IV) compound 5-C5H5)2C6H5C=CH-COO>*C6H5CCCOOH>.X-ray structure analysis showed the unit cell to be composed of a titanocene metallacycle in which titanium is η5-bonded to two cyclopentadienyl rings and to one carbon and one oxygen atom in a 5-membered metallacycle , the whole molecule being in a 1/1 hydrogen bonded association with phenylpropionic acid.The complex crystallizes in the monoclinic space group P21/c with unit cell paramaters a 12.435(4), b 13.046(4), c 14.326(5) Angstroem, β 92.50(4) deg, and Dc 1.34 g cm-3 for Z=4.Least-squares refinement based on 1812 independent observed reflections led to a final R value of 0.079.Reaction of dimethyltitanocene with phenylpropiolic acid in toluene gives the compound 5-C5H5)2Ti(OOC-CC-C6H5)2> as an air stable orange crystalline solid.
